SoundHound AI is currently making waves in the technology sector, experiencing a staggering 175% increase in its stock price over just three months. This remarkable surge comes amidst a volatile market, showcasing SoundHound’s potential as a leader in AI-driven voice recognition technology.
SoundHound’s voice recognition technology is more than just enhancing user experiences; it’s transforming how businesses interact with customers. The technology’s widespread adoption is evident across diverse sectors, including over 10,000 restaurants and numerous partnerships with electric vehicle manufacturers, paving the way for seamless communication.
One of the standout innovations is the Polaris model, a proprietary voice recognition system trained extensively on billions of conversations. This provides unparalleled accuracy and reliability, setting SoundHound apart from the competition, who still wrestle with accuracy challenges.
SoundHound’s impressive 89% year-over-year revenue growth has taken its earnings to over $25 million. Projected revenues of $155 million to $175 million by 2025 further point to a robust growth trajectory. While the company isn’t profitable yet, its strong cash reserves of $136 million provide a solid foundation for future expansion.
However, potential investors should consider the risks. Despite its promise, SoundHound trades at a steep 75.4 times its trailing sales, a valuation considerably higher than tech giants like NVIDIA and Microsoft. This high valuation could result in volatility if growth expectations aren’t met.
